All seven spillway gates at Beaver Dam are open one foot, releasing water after heavy rain overnight in Northwest Arkansas.

Beaver Lake level hit 1129.6 at 10 a.m. Thursday. The gates are releasing water at a rate of 11,250 cubic feet per second, according to a Thursday news release.

The National Weather Service reported about 2.5 inches of rain at Northwest Arkansas Regional Airport and about 1.5 inches in Fayetteville Tuesday night to Thursday morning, according to a social media post from the National Weather Service.

A flash flood watch is in effect through noon Thursday for much of the region, according to another post.
